Global Segment Leader, PU Rigid & Molded (m/f/d)

Momentive Performance Materials

Job Title:

Global Segment Leader, PU Rigid & Molded (m/f/d)

Summary:

Development and implementation of the Global Segment strategy, including Sales, Marketing, Strategic Growth Programs, and Technology/NPI Initiatives for the PU Rigid, Molded, Specialties Segment.

Direct responsibility for the Sales, Marketing & Application Development functions, and strategic alignment with Technology to support existing business and to develop new business in line with the global Segment strategy.

Responsibilities Include:

  • Grow the Segment through Share Expansion, NPIs, New Applications, Global Translations & Business Development. Development and execution of the segment's annual and long-term operating plans (Revenue, Volume, Margin, NPI Vitality).
  • Develop short-range and Long-range Strategy and Business Plan, ensuring that the segment has adequate visibility to market trends. Serves as a source of voice of the customer, marketing intelligence. Manage key external industry relationships that will allow the segment to position products optimally and develop new products.
  • Own the establishment and execution of direct selling account strategies, key account plans, demand plans, pricing, and channel strategy for the segment (e.g., distribution, agents). Ensure that internal personnel as well as channel partners are properly trained and motivated to succeed
  • Responsible for all aspects of People recruiting, people development, organizational evolution, and global succession planning for the Sales, Marketing & Application teams.
  • Partner with procurement to develop/drive a procurement strategy that results in strategic partnerships with key suppliers and cost-effective material costs and savings.

Qualifications:

The following are required for the role

  • A strategic-minded business management professional with 15+ years of business leadership experience on a regional and global level, with a solid track record of leading growth through innovation in the specialty chemical space.
  • Bachelor's degree in relevant area.
  • 10 years of experience in the polyurethane industry/specialty chemicals.
  • 10-15 years of commercial sales experience, preferably in the Polyurethane industry with a multinational company.
  • Experience in a sales management role with exposure to developed and emerging countries.
  • Strong background in people development: effective in hiring, coaching, training, motivating, and developing increased competency levels, performance, and innovation/change.
  • Experience in the creation and execution of annual and long-term plans that include market trend and share analysis and demonstrated profit growth and business expansion.
  • Marketing competencies and experience should include Strategic Marketing, Value Proposition Development, Market Segmentation, and New Product Launches.
  • High level of Business financial acumen - experience and understanding of P&L, cash flow, working capital, and return on capital employed.
  • Exceptional listening and communication skills – verbal, written, and formal presentations.
  • Strong interpersonal and executive presentation skills.
  • Travel 30-50%

The following are preferred for this role

  • Polyurethane Rigid Molded and Specialities experience.
